Tetra Cleaning Bacteria is a scientifically formulated liquid blend of multiple beneficial bacterial strains designed to restore and maintain biological balance in aquariums. It enhances filtration by breaking down ammonia and organic waste, ensuring crystal-clear water and a healthy environment for aquatic life. Easy to dose with a measuring cap, it’s recommended for monthly use and after any tank maintenance or fish additions, making it an essential solution for both novice and experienced aquarium keepers.

I bought my wife a little 3 gallon aquarium. It is divided in the middle. Water cascades from the taller side to the lower side. She has it on her desk. It's pretty great! Keeping a small tank like this can be harder than maintaining a big tank. The water parameters can go bad in a second, where in a big tank you have some time before it would crash. I've kept freshwater and saltwater tanks for years. I even used to breed seahorses. So I know how important it is to keep water quality pristine for fish and other inhabitants. I use Tetra Cleaning Bacteria simply because that's what it is. Beneficial bacteria. Tetra adds some minerals too. Now this tiny tank has a tiny internal filter. It has some ceramic media and a mechanical filter pad in it. I added two tiny air stone powered sponge filters to aid with filtration. Some people will tell you that a product like this isn't necessary. That the aquariums already have a colony of beneficial bacteria in them. That what your tank has is enough. Well, I am sure that is true for some aquariums. I am just not sure that is true about ALL aquariums. The amount of filter media on this tank is small. This tank's inhabitants include: a male betta, two nerite snails, some hitchhiker bladder snails, 13 cherry shrimp and it's packed full of live plants. I can tell you that it has been pretty easy maintaining this tank. My wife maintains it well. She does NOT overfeed the inhabitants. (She used to have a freshwater angel fish tank and a big salt water reef tank, so she knows what she is doing too). The parameters are great! I do weekly partial water changes. I keep an eye on the filter media. I did just switch from the filter "cartridge" made for this filter and cut a piece of 8 layer sponge filter media for the internal filter to replace it. That will also give a home to even more beneficial bacteria. All I can say is that I am 100% convinced that this product works. Her nano tank and my 75 gallon tank are doing great! I've added a pic of my 75 gallon tank too. The water is crystal clear and the parameters are also excellent. Bottom like: I highly recommend Tetra Cleaning Bacteria. (Oh yeah, almost forgot. I used Tetra SafeStart Plus on both tanks when I set them up. I do believe that was the way to go. You cannot argue with our results).
